Why Choose a Treadmill with Incline?
A treadmill with an incline provides an unique benefit over standard designs. Here are a few of the most engaging reasons to opt for an incline treadmill:
Enhanced Caloric Burn: Running or walking on an incline increases the intensity of your exercise, which causes greater calorie expenditure compared to flat surfaces. Studies suggest that you can burn up to 50% more calories when working out on an incline.
Enhanced Cardiovascular Fitness: Incline training elevates heart rate faster, enabling users to accomplish cardiovascular advantages in much shorter durations. Frequently integrating incline exercises can enhance overall stamina and endurance.
Strengthening of Muscles: Incline walking or running efficiently targets various muscle groups, particularly the glutes, hamstrings, calves, and quadriceps. This extensive technique makes sure balanced lower body strength development, vital for different athletic pursuits.
Joint-Friendly Workouts: Unlike outside running, where surfaces can be unforeseeable, incline treadmills offer a regulated environment. They take in impact, minimizing the danger of injury to joints and making them a much safer alternative for those recuperating from injuries.
Versatile Workout Options: Most incline treadmills come equipped with various pre-set programs and customizable settings, allowing users to tailor workouts based upon their physical fitness levels and goals.
Secret Features to Consider
When deciding on the best treadmill with incline for home use, a number of features merit factor to consider to ensure it satisfies private physical fitness requirements. Here's a list of important aspects:
Incline Range: A wider series of incline levels provides increased options for workout strength. Look for makers that use a minimum of a 10-15% incline.
Motor Power: A stronger motor (continuous responsibility ranked at 2.5-5.0 HP) is important for keeping performance, particularly during high-intensity incline exercises.
Running Surface Size: A longer and broader belt is more suitable, particularly for taller users or those who have longer strides, ensuring a comfy running experience.
Cushioning System: Quality cushioning considerably impacts exercise convenience and can help lessen joint tension.
Weight Capacity: Check the machine's weight limit to guarantee it can accommodate all prospective users securely.
Portability: If space is a problem, consider treadmills with foldable designs or those that come with integrated transport wheels.
Entertainment Features: Features like Bluetooth connectivity, speakers, and tablet holders can make workouts more pleasurable and engaging.
Tips for Effective Incline Workouts
To take full advantage of the advantages of your incline treadmill workouts, think about the following tips:
Warm-Up and Cool Down: Start with a 5-10 minute warm-up on a flat incline before increasing the gradient. Similarly, cool down at a gentle rate after extreme sessions to assist healing.
Mix It Up: Alternate in between incline walking, jogging, and sprinting to keep exercises diverse and appealing.
Make Use Of Handrails Sparingly: While some support can be helpful, relying too greatly on hand rails can reduce workout efficiency.
Stay Hydrated: Keep water on hand, particularly if participating in high-intensity workouts to neutralize dehydration.
FAQs1. What's the difference in between handbook and automatic incline treadmills?
Manual incline treadmills need users to set the incline level manually and typically supply less sophisticated functions. In contrast, automatic incline treadmills adjust the angle digitally, permitting seamless transitions during exercises.
2. How frequently should I utilize an incline treadmill?
To enjoy the maximum benefits, aim for a minimum of thrice weekly sessions of 20-30 minutes. Slowly increase both duration and strength as physical fitness enhances.
3. Can I reduce weight by utilizing an incline treadmill?
Yes, using an incline treadmill can significantly aid weight-loss by burning more calories and enhancing your exercise intensity.
4. Exist any threats connected with using an incline treadmill?
As with any physical activity, users ought to be mindful. It's essential to utilize proper type and begin at a modest incline level to avoid unnecessary stress or injury.
5. Do I need an individual fitness instructor to utilize an incline treadmill successfully?
While personal fitness instructors can supply tailored physical fitness plans, numerous users effectively utilize incline treadmills separately. It's recommended to inform oneself about appropriate form and exercise strategies through credible sources or educational videos.
